执行安装redis报错undefined reference to `__sync_add_and_fetch_4'
2024-09-01 07:00:47
执行make命令时报错:
zmalloc.o: In function `zmalloc_used_memory':
/var/lib/tcommsvr/redis-2.8.0-rc4/src/zmalloc.c:223: undefined reference to `__sync_add_and_fetch_4'
collect2: ld returned 1 exit status
make[1]: *** [redis-server] Error 1
make[1]: Leaving directory `/var/lib/tcommsvr/redis-2.8.0-rc4/src'
make: *** [all] Error 2
产生原因:
linux为32位版本。
查看方式:getconf LONG_BIT
解决办法:
执行make命令时加参数:make CFLAGS="-march=i686"
最新文章
- [HIHO1393]网络流三·二分图多重匹配
- 【C51】74HC573芯片
- CSS实现垂直居中
- NetBIOS
- 1. while循环(当循环) 2. do{}while()循环 3. switch cose(多选一) 例子:当选循环下求百鸡百钱 用 switch cose人机剪刀石头布
- 在repeart中获取行数据
- 通过百度地图API实现搜索地址--第三方开源--百度地图(三)
- Matlab中sortrows函数解析
- 判断ios是app第一次启动
- python2 ----函数字典的使用
- 淘宝PK京东:哥刷的不是广告,刷的是存在
- 惠普4431s 笔记本配置
- c语言可变参函数探究
- selenium RC
- JDBC操作数据库之批处理
- Docker for windows : 安装Redis
- Plant(𝐶𝑜𝑑𝑒𝐹𝑜𝑟𝑐𝑒𝑠 − 185𝐴)
- Java转python第一天
- iview给radio按钮组件加点击事件
- vue打包后图片找不到情况
热门文章
- EasyNVR对接EasyCloud视频云平台进行云端录像
- shell中${}的使用
- Xamarin.Forms学习之Page Navigation(二)
- 巨蟒django之CRM2 展示客户列表&;&;分页
- Constructor Acquires, Destructor Releases Resource Acquisition Is Initialization
- dev 转自
- Linux下Ngnix及PHP重启命令
- 2014牡丹江——Known Notation
- ApexSQL Recover 恢复一个被drop的表的数据
- C语言定义一个指针变量